How To Choose The Best Bedroom Door Handle

Bedroom door handles are not all built the same. The wrong choice means a sagging lever within a year, a latch that sticks in humidity, or a finish that chips off in months. Focus on three critical factors: the locking mechanism type, the build quality grade, and the dimensional fit for your door.

Privacy vs. Passage vs. Keyed Entry

For a bedroom, a privacy handle is the standard choice. It locks from the inside with a push button or turn button and can be unlocked from the outside with a small tool (coin, screwdriver, or included release pin). This gives you privacy without needing keys. A passage handle (no lock) is only suitable for closets or hall doors, and a keyed entry handle is overkill unless the bedroom is also used as a secure home office.

BHMA Grade Certification

The Builders Hardware Manufacturers Association (BHMA) grades door hardware on a scale of 1 to 3. Grade 1 is the highest, rated for over 800,000 cycles and the most abuse — common in commercial settings. Grade 2 is rated for around 400,000 cycles and is the sweet spot for residential bedrooms. Grade 3 is the entry-level residential standard, often found on builder-grade handles. If you want a handle that still feels tight after years of daily use, look for at least Grade 2 certification.

Lever Wobble and Spring Design

The single most common complaint with lever-style handles is sagging over time. Quality handles use dual compression springs inside the rose assembly to keep the lever upright and wobble-free. Cheaper models rely on a single spring or no spring at all, which causes the lever to droop and feel loose within weeks. Always check for explicit mention of dual spring construction in the product description.

FAQ

Can I use a passage handle on a bedroom door?
You can, but it’s not recommended for bedrooms used for sleeping or changing. A passage handle has no locking mechanism, meaning anyone can enter at any time without indication. For bedroom privacy, always choose a privacy handle with a push-button or turn-button lock.
Why does my bedroom door lever keep sagging?
Sagging is almost always caused by a missing or worn-out compression spring inside the lever rose. Handles without dual spring construction rely on friction alone to stay horizontal. Over time, gravity wins and the lever droops. The fix is to replace the handle with one that explicitly uses dual compression springs, such as the Kwikset Halifax.
What does adjustable backset mean on a door handle?
Backset is the distance from the edge of the door to the center of the handle hole. Standard residential doors typically have a 2-3/8″ or 2-3/4″ backset. An adjustable latch lets you twist or slide to match your door’s exact measurement without buying a separate latch. Most handles in this guide support both common backsets.
Is keyed entry necessary for a bedroom door?
Only if you use the bedroom as a secure home office, store valuables, or need to restrict access by key rather than by the internal turn-button. For standard bedroom privacy needs, a keyless push-button lock is sufficient and more convenient — you never risk locking yourself out without a key.
